Abstract
The prediction of stock closing quotation is very difficult because the time series seem random but not random completely. So a Back-Propagation Neurons Network based on Improved Levenberg-Marquardt algorithm was presented in this paper. The nonlinear mapping characteristic of the Back-Propagation Neural Network makes it can approach to every function in any precision. The Improved Levenberg-Marquardt algorithm can accelerate the speed of convergence, so it is easy to approach to the global optimal solution, not the local optimal solutions and. The prediction experiment shows that the Improved Levenberg-Marquardt algorithm works better than traditional Auto-regressive Moving-Average model.
